You can use _Bool with no #include very much like you can use int or double; it is a C99 keyword. The macro is defined in …
WebBoolean Types. A boolean data type is declared with the bool keyword and can only take the values true or false. When the value is returned, true = 1 and false = 0. Example. bool isCodingFun = true; bool isFishTasty = false; cout << isCodingFun; // Outputs 1 (true)
